
Pro-Ject Phono Box S2 Phono Preamplifier
A transparent, high-gain phono preamp that rivals costlier options with its adjustable subsonic filter and precise loading.
Pro-Ject knows phono stages. The Phono Box S2 is their compact solution for anyone who wants to hear what their vinyl records actually sound like. It uses a dual mono configuration, which means each channel gets its own dedicated amplification path. This keeps the stereo image clean and prevents crosstalk between left and right. The result is a soundstage that feels wider and more precise than most integrated preamps can deliver.
Inside, you get audiophile-grade amplification modules and polypropylene WIMA capacitors. These components handle signal processing with very low noise. The RIAA equalization is precise, so your records sound balanced across the entire frequency range. It supports moving magnet and moving coil cartridges, which gives you flexibility if you upgrade your turntable later. The included remote control is a welcome addition for adjusting settings without walking over to the unit.
There are no major flaws here for the price. The chassis is small and can feel lightweight compared to bulkier gear, but it runs cool and fits easily into tight AV racks. If you are using a basic entry-level turntable, the improvement over built-in preamps will be immediate and obvious.
